// capture_ftp.go — application-level FTP/SFTP upload orchestration.
//
// Design rationale:
// - FTP/SFTP returns a remote filesystem path, not necessarily a public URL,
// so this flow stays separate from the OSSProvider-based S3 pipeline.
// - A tiny uploader interface keeps protocol libraries out of the
// application layer and makes the upload/copy/notify sequence unit-testable.
// - The dated filename layout is shared with SSH/SCP while FTP-specific path
// validation prevents an invalid prefix from escaping the login root.
package application
import (
"context"
"fmt"
"log/slog"
"strings"
"time"
"github.com/mmmy/snapgo/internal/domain"
"github.com/mmmy/snapgo/internal/infrastructure/clipboard"
)
// ftpSvcLog returns an application-layer FTP logger bound to the current
// default slog handler.
func ftpSvcLog() *slog.Logger { return slog.Default().With("component", "application.ftp") }
// FTPUploader abstracts both FTP and SFTP adapters.
type FTPUploader interface {
// Upload stores data at remoteRelPath, relative to the authenticated
// account's login root.
Upload(ctx context.Context, remoteRelPath string, data []byte) error
}
// CaptureAndFTPService wires captured PNG bytes → FTP/SFTP → clipboard →
// notification.
type CaptureAndFTPService struct {
Uploader FTPUploader
Clipboard clipboard.Writer
Notifier Notifier
Cfg domain.FTPConfig
}
// ExecuteWithBytes uploads previously captured PNG bytes and copies the exact
// remote path semantics shown in Settings: FTP paths are rooted at "/", while
// SFTP paths are relative to the authenticated user's home directory.
func (s *CaptureAndFTPService) ExecuteWithBytes(ctx context.Context, pngBytes []byte) error {
if s.Uploader == nil {
s.notifyFailure("FTP/SFTP not configured")
return fmt.Errorf("ftp uploader is nil")
}
if len(pngBytes) == 0 {
s.notifyFailure("empty screenshot")
return fmt.Errorf("empty screenshot")
}
relPath, err := buildFTPRemotePath(s.Cfg.PathPrefix)
if err != nil {
s.notifyFailure(err.Error())
return err
}
protocol := normalizedFTPProtocol(s.Cfg.Protocol)
start := time.Now()
ftpSvcLog().Info("file-transfer pipeline start",
"protocol", protocol,
"host", s.Cfg.Host,
"user", s.Cfg.User,
"port", s.Cfg.Port,
"size", len(pngBytes),
"remote_path", relPath,
"strict_host_key", s.Cfg.StrictHostKey)
if err := s.Uploader.Upload(ctx, relPath, pngBytes); err != nil {
ftpSvcLog().Error("file-transfer upload failed",
"protocol", protocol,
"remote_path", relPath,
"elapsed", time.Since(start),
"err", err)
s.notifyFailure(strings.ToUpper(protocol) + " upload failed: " + err.Error())
return err
}
clipText := ftpShareText(protocol, relPath)
if s.Clipboard != nil {
if err := s.Clipboard.WriteText(clipText); err != nil {
s.notifyFailure("clipboard write failed: " + err.Error())
return err
}
}
if s.Notifier != nil {
s.Notifier.NotifySuccess(clipText)
}
ftpSvcLog().Info("file-transfer pipeline done",
"protocol", protocol,
"remote_path", relPath,
"total_elapsed", time.Since(start))
return nil
}
// buildFTPRemotePath validates the user-controlled prefix before reusing the
// existing dated remote-path generator shared with SSH/SCP.
func buildFTPRemotePath(prefix string) (string, error) {
if err := validateFTPPathPrefix(prefix); err != nil {
return "", err
}
prefix = strings.TrimSpace(prefix)
prefix = strings.TrimPrefix(prefix, "~")
prefix = strings.TrimLeft(prefix, "/")
return buildRemoteRelPath(prefix), nil
}
func validateFTPPathPrefix(prefix string) error {
if strings.ContainsAny(prefix, "\x00\r\n\\") {
return fmt.Errorf("FTP/SFTP path contains an invalid character")
}
prefix = strings.TrimSpace(prefix)
prefix = strings.TrimPrefix(prefix, "~")
prefix = strings.TrimLeft(prefix, "/")
for _, segment := range strings.Split(prefix, "/") {
if segment == ".." {
return fmt.Errorf("FTP/SFTP path must stay inside the login directory")
}
}
return nil
}
func normalizedFTPProtocol(protocol string) string {
if protocol == domain.FTPProtocolSFTP {
return domain.FTPProtocolSFTP
}
return domain.FTPProtocolFTP
}
func ftpShareText(protocol, relPath string) string {
if protocol == domain.FTPProtocolSFTP {
return "~/" + relPath
}
return "/" + relPath
}
func (s *CaptureAndFTPService) notifyFailure(reason string) {
if s.Notifier != nil {
s.Notifier.NotifyFailure(reason)
}
}

package application
import (
"context"
"errors"
"strings"
"testing"
"github.com/mmmy/snapgo/internal/domain"
)
type fakeFTPUploader struct {
path string
data []byte
err error
}
func (f *fakeFTPUploader) Upload(_ context.Context, remoteRelPath string, data []byte) error {
f.path = remoteRelPath
f.data = append([]byte(nil), data...)
return f.err
}
func TestCaptureAndFTPServiceUploadsAndCopiesFTPPath(t *testing.T) {
uploader := &fakeFTPUploader{}
clip := &fakeClipboard{}
notifier := &fakeNotifier{}
svc := &CaptureAndFTPService{
Uploader: uploader,
Clipboard: clip,
Notifier: notifier,
Cfg: domain.FTPConfig{
Protocol: domain.FTPProtocolFTP,
PathPrefix: "snapgo/",
},
}
if err := svc.ExecuteWithBytes(context.Background(), []byte("png")); err != nil {
t.Fatalf("upload FTP screenshot: %v", err)
}
if string(uploader.data) != "png" {
t.Fatalf("expected PNG bytes, got %q", string(uploader.data))
}
if !strings.HasPrefix(uploader.path, "snapgo/") || !strings.HasSuffix(uploader.path, ".png") {
t.Fatalf("unexpected remote path %q", uploader.path)
}
if clip.text != "/"+uploader.path {
t.Fatalf("expected FTP root path copied, got %q", clip.text)
}
if notifier.success != clip.text {
t.Fatalf("expected success notification %q, got %q", clip.text, notifier.success)
}
}
func TestCaptureAndFTPServiceCopiesSFTPHomePath(t *testing.T) {
uploader := &fakeFTPUploader{}
clip := &fakeClipboard{}
svc := &CaptureAndFTPService{
Uploader: uploader,
Clipboard: clip,
Cfg: domain.FTPConfig{
Protocol: domain.FTPProtocolSFTP,
PathPrefix: "images",
},
}
if err := svc.ExecuteWithBytes(context.Background(), []byte("png")); err != nil {
t.Fatalf("upload SFTP screenshot: %v", err)
}
if clip.text != "~/"+uploader.path {
t.Fatalf("expected SFTP home path copied, got %q", clip.text)
}
}
func TestCaptureAndFTPServiceRejectsTraversalBeforeUpload(t *testing.T) {
uploader := &fakeFTPUploader{}
notifier := &fakeNotifier{}
svc := &CaptureAndFTPService{
Uploader: uploader,
Notifier: notifier,
Cfg: domain.FTPConfig{
Protocol: domain.FTPProtocolSFTP,
PathPrefix: "../../outside",
},
}
err := svc.ExecuteWithBytes(context.Background(), []byte("png"))
if err == nil {
t.Fatal("expected traversal prefix to fail")
}
if uploader.path != "" {
t.Fatalf("uploader should not run, got path %q", uploader.path)
}
if notifier.failure == "" {
t.Fatal("expected failure notification")
}
}
func TestCaptureAndFTPServiceSurfacesUploadFailure(t *testing.T) {
want := errors.New("server unavailable")
uploader := &fakeFTPUploader{err: want}
clip := &fakeClipboard{}
notifier := &fakeNotifier{}
svc := &CaptureAndFTPService{
Uploader: uploader,
Clipboard: clip,
Notifier: notifier,
Cfg: domain.FTPConfig{Protocol: domain.FTPProtocolFTP},
}
err := svc.ExecuteWithBytes(context.Background(), []byte("png"))
if !errors.Is(err, want) {
t.Fatalf("expected %v, got %v", want, err)
}
if clip.text != "" {
t.Fatalf("clipboard should remain empty, got %q", clip.text)
}
if !strings.Contains(notifier.failure, "server unavailable") {
t.Fatalf("unexpected failure notification %q", notifier.failure)
}
}
func TestBuildFTPRemotePathNormalizesLoginRootMarkers(t *testing.T) {
remotePath, err := buildFTPRemotePath(" ~////snapgo/ ")
if err != nil {
t.Fatalf("build remote path: %v", err)
}
if strings.HasPrefix(remotePath, "/") || !strings.HasPrefix(remotePath, "snapgo/") {
t.Fatalf("expected relative snapgo path, got %q", remotePath)
}
}
